Minimal access aortic surgery.

Hiroaki Osada1, Kenji Minatoya1

  • 1Department of Cardiovascular Surgery, Graduate School of Medicine, Kyoto University, 54 Shogoin-Kawaharacho, Sakyo-Ku, Kyoto, 606-8507 Japan.

Indian Journal of Thoracic and Cardiovascular Surgery
|December 14, 2023
PubMed
Summary

This study offers practical tips for minimally invasive aortic surgery using small incisions in the right thoracic cavity. It details techniques for ascending, arch, and aortic root replacement via partial sternotomy, illustrated with surgical videos.

Area of Science:

  • Cardiovascular Surgery
  • Minimally Invasive Surgical Techniques

Background:

  • Advancements in thoracic surgery enable minimally invasive approaches.
  • Partial sternotomy is utilized for complex aortic procedures.

Purpose of the Study:

  • To present surgical tips for small incision aortic surgery.
  • To demonstrate techniques for ascending, arch, and aortic root replacement.

Main Methods:

  • Surgical videos of two cases are presented.
  • Focus on small incisions through the right thoracic cavity.
  • Partial sternotomy approach for aortic replacement.

Main Results:

  • Demonstration of practical techniques for small incision aortic surgery.
  • Successful application of partial sternotomy for ascending, arch, and aortic root replacement.

Conclusions:

  • Small incision aortic surgery is feasible and effective.
  • Partial sternotomy offers a viable approach for complex aortic procedures.
